Output 108035f3809ebe5e18519aa5d34164f4edb4ab47ee51afaa3edc6028a418e774:2

value
160822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b96d9f38da7a8110b937d71cafdf7c210d22acaa OP_EQUALVERIFY OP_CHECKSIG
address
1HuTLA3sSH3uaNyo2fAJJsvL2QEHDu5wWa
transaction
108035f3809ebe5e18519aa5d34164f4edb4ab47ee51afaa3edc6028a418e774
confirmations
565026
spent
true